HollywoodNews.com: Artists such as Linkin Park, Enrique Iglesias, Slash, Red Jumpsuit Apparatus and Counting Crows have contributed new songs to the nonprofit group Music for Relief to support Save the Children’s emergency response efforts in Japan.
The exclusive and growing catalog of songs can be downloaded at www.downloadtodonate.org for a donation of $10 or more. All contributions will go to Save the Children for the duration of the campaign, which runs through May 11.
“Children are always the most vulnerable in any disaster,” said Charles MacCormack, president and CEO of Save the Children. “We are grateful this partnership with Music for Relief will help address the immediate and ongoing needs of children and families impacted by this tragedy.”

The Red Jumpsuit Apparatus have completed recording new materials for their second major-label studio effort "Lonely Road". They are scheduled to release the Howard Benson-produced album on February 3 across U.S.
In regard of the new record, lead vocalist Ronnie Winter says the album will bring similar sounds to their previous album "Don't You Fake It". "We're really psyched about these tracks and the new record and hope you are, too," he states. "Just like 'Don't You Fake It', you can be sure 'Lonely Road' will tie together these and a bunch of other sounds in a classic, but new-and-improved Rja-sounding way."
"Lonely Road" is aimed to follow up the band's 2007 studio effort "Don't You Fake It", which has scanned over a million copies in the U.S. to date. Led by single "You Better Pray", it becomes their first LP since guitarist Elias Reidy left the band "to pursue his own music.

The Red Jumpsuit Apparatus have completed recording their sophomore major-label studio album "Lonely Road" and plan to drop it across U.S. on February 3, 2009 through Virgin Records. The effort is aimed to follow up their 2006 debut LP "Don't You Fake It", which has scanned more than a million copies in the U.S.
In addition to the announcement of the effort's release date, official tracklisting for the album has also been brought forward. Eleven new songs, including singles "You Better Pray" and "No Spell", have been confirmed to appear on the forthcoming LP.
Prior to the release of "Lonely Road", "You Better Pray" has hit radio airplays. Alongside a fan's only studio demo for song "Pen and Paper", the single is available for stream on their official website and their MySpace page.
"We're really psyched about these tracks and the new record and hope you are, too," proclaims lead vocalist Ronnie Winter.

General Hospital actress Julie Berman married commercial real estate broker Michael Grady in Los Angeles on Aug. 15, her rep Nicole Nassar tells People exclusively. Berman, 24, who plays the troubled daughter of Luke and Laura Spencer on the popular daytime show, wed Grady, 27, in a Roman Catholic ceremony in the Sacred Heart Chapel at L.A.'s Loyola Marymount University. A reception at a private home in Pacific Palisades followed. "Mike is my best friend, and ultimately he is my soul mate," Berman tells People. "He's the guy I want to do everything with – the guy I want to be with when he's old and wrinkly.
